Output ea112b89e91fa09213cce46962f74ba7bde7e76db7becc87c8e70de54599267b:3

value
22640000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afb32edf11a3ec0411bbdad6befe79e24596158a OP_EQUAL
address
3Hi2pyRArY4t1HNxnzXaiikETRXnNmCMa6
transaction
ea112b89e91fa09213cce46962f74ba7bde7e76db7becc87c8e70de54599267b
spent
true